DA case order: Is the long wait for lakhs of state government employees, teachers, and pensioners in West Bengal finally coming to an end? A major update regarding the final verdict of the Dearness Allowance (DA) case has emerged, creating a significant buzz among state government employees. Shri Maloy Mukherjee (Maloy Babu), the secretary of the Confederation of State Government Employees, has provided crucial information that points towards a potential date for the verdict.
According to this update, a special bench has been constituted in the Supreme Court to announce the DA case verdict. This news has sparked a fresh wave of hope among the employees, who have been eagerly awaiting the final resolution of this long-pending case.
Special Bench Formation and Potential Date
The Confederation has informed that there is a strong possibility of the DA case verdict being announced on the upcoming Wednesday, 12th November 2025. The case is scheduled to be heard at 3 PM on that day in a division bench comprising Hon’ble Justice Sanjay Karol and Hon’ble Justice Prashant Kumar Mishra.

Representatives of the employees’ union believe that the formation of this special bench is a major indication that the DA case verdict is imminent. According to them, a special bench is typically formed to deliver a final judgment after a lengthy hearing process.
How Strong is the Possibility of a Verdict?
Shri Maloy Mukherjee stated that since the extensive hearing phase in this case is already complete and a list mentioning the names of the justices for a special bench has been published, they are very hopeful that the final verdict might be delivered on that very day. He also mentioned that the case number and other relevant details are included in the list.
However, it is important to note that this is a strong possibility, not a confirmation. Whether the final verdict will be announced on that day depends entirely on the Hon’ble Court. Nevertheless, the formation of the special bench has raised expectations to a new high. Now, all eyes are on November 12th to see if it brings good news for the state government employees.
